Data-Driven Decision Making: A Product Manager's Research Toolkit
For product managers, researching the market and users is essential. It provides valuable insights that can inform product roadmaps. This article serves as a guide to help product managers effectively conduct research, transforming data into actionable choices.
- Start by clearly identifying your research aims. What questions are you trying to answer?
- Focus on qualitative and quantitative methods that align with your objectives. Consider surveys, user interviews, A/B testing, and data analysis.
- Present your findings in a clear and compelling manner. Use visuals like charts, graphs, and diagrams to illustrate key trends.
